Frequently Asked Questions
How much does a Registered Nurse make in Hawaii?
The median salary for a Registered Nurse in Hawaii is $176,615 per year, which is 117% higher than the national median of $81,220.
How many Registered Nurse jobs are there in Hawaii?
There are approximately 18,256 registered nurse positions in Hawaii.
What is the salary range for a Registered Nurse in Hawaii?
Salaries range from $105,969 (10th percentile) to $296,713 (90th percentile), with a median of $176,615.
